Sun Tzu 孙武
Sun Tzu, also known as Sunzi, was an ancient Chinese military strategist, philosopher, and author, best known for his influential work, "The Art of War." Believed to have lived during the Eastern Zhou period, around the 5th century BC, Sun Tzu's insights into the nature of warfare and strategy have shaped military thinking for centuries, extending beyond the battlefield into business, sports, and personal development. His teachings emphasize the importance of adaptability, intelligence, and the psychological aspects of conflict, making them relevant even in today's fast-paced world.
Though little is known about his personal life, the wisdom encapsulated in Sun Tzu's writings continues to resonate with leaders and thinkers across various fields. His concise yet profound principles encourage readers to reflect on strategy and decision-making in their own lives.
